Higher Wing Prices Hurt Earnings Expansion at Buffalo Wild Wings

Tuesday morning, Buffalo Wild Wings (click ticker for report: ) announced solid fourth quarter results. Revenue surged 38% year-over-year to $304 million, easily exceeding consensus estimates. Earnings, on the other hand, grew 22% year-over-year to $0.89 per share, falling short of consensus estimates by several cents. Revenue growth at company-owned restaurants totaled 39% year-over-year to $283 million, though same-store sales performance was somewhat modest (up 5.8% compared to the year-ago period). This compared unfavorably to franchise-owned stores, where same-store sales advanced 7.4% versus the fourth quarter of 2011. We think the divergence was a result of franchise-owned restaurants being comparatively younger stores than the more mature company-owned restaurants (we believe performance will eventually converge, however). McDonald’s Going After the Wing Market

In a somewhat surprising move, McDonald’s (click ticker for report: ) is following up the chicken McBites with its own iteration of chicken wings. The “Mighty Wings” are currently being rolled out across 500 Chicago area restaurants (one location we visited advertised them, but had yet to receive the raw goods). Although wing prices are high and have been hurting profit expansion at Buffalo Wild Wings (click ticker for report: ), we like the move. Not only does it fulfill the need for the company to diversify its menu offerings, but we also think the new menu item could generate incremental revenue (assuming the wings are differentiated from other McDonald’s chicken offerings). Buffalo Wild Wings Suffers as Inflation Hurts the Bottom Line

Fast growing restaurant chain Buffalo Wild Wings (click ticker for report: ) announced weak third quarter results Tuesday afternoon. Revenue grew 25% year-over-year to $247 million, but that figure was a bit lower than consensus estimates. Earnings fell 7% to $0.57 per share, a few cents lower than consensus expectations. The big drag on profitability has been wing prices, which are 70% higher than a year ago at $1.97 per pound. As a result, cost of sales jumped 270 basis points to 31.2%. Management noted that wing prices have remained high throughout the beginning of the fourth quarter, and profitability is expected to increase 15% year-over-year in 2013. Best Idea Buffalo Wild Wings Posts Strong First-Quarter Results

Best idea Buffalo Wild Wings () reported strong first-quarter results Tuesday that support our view that the firm’s expansion efforts are still in the early innings. Though we liked the firm’s quarter, Buffalo Wild Wings is getting a bit pricey at these levels and we may look to scale back our position even further in the portfolio of our Best Ideas Newsletter on continued strength. Our fair value estimate for the bar-and-restaurant chain remains unchanged. The firm’s first-quarter revenue advanced an impressive 37.9%, as sales from company-owned restaurants jumped more than 40% from the same period a year ago.
